函数如下: def showNnumber(numbers): for n in numbers: print(n) 下面那些在调用函数时会报错
showNumber((12,4,5))
举一反三
- 已知函数定义如下:def show(numbers):for n in numbers:print(n)下面那些在调用函数时会报错( ) A: show([2,3,4,5]) B: show((2,3,4,5)) C: show(2,3,4,5) D: show("2345")
- 函数如下:defshowNnumber(numbers):forninnumbers:print(n)下面哪些在调用函数时会报错? A: showNumer([2,4,5]) B: showNnumber(‘abcesf’) C: showNnumber(3.4) D: showNumber((12,4,5))
- 执行下方代码,其中选项( )在调用函数时会报错。def shownumber(numbers):for n in numbers:print(n) A: shownumber([2,4,5]) B: shownumber('abcesf') C: shownumber(3.4) D: shownumber((12,4,5))
- 定义了如下函数,那么在调用函数时会报错的是( )def showNum(number): for n in number: print(n) A: showNum([2,4,5]) B: showNum(‘abcesf’) C: showNum(3,4) D: showNum((12,4,5))
- 中国大学MOOC: 定义函数如下:def compute(*numbers): s = 1 for n in numbers: s = s * n + n return s以下哪些选项的输入可以得到21的结果?
内容
- 0
下面那些在调用函数时不会报错 A: showNumer([2,4,5]) B: showNnumber(‘abcesf’) C: showNnumber(3.4) D: showNumber((12,4,5))
- 1
定义函数如下:def compute(*numbers): s = 1 for n in numbers: s = s * n + n return s以下哪些选项的输入可以得到21的结果? A: compute([3, 3]) B: nums = [1, 2, 3]; compute(nums) C: compute([3, 2, 1]) D: nums = (3, 3); compute(*nums)
- 2
定义如下的函数,下面哪种函数调用会出错___________。def defP(a1,a2=2,a3=3)print(a1,a2,a3)
- 3
定义函数test()如下: [img=176x110]17da6f9ee30bb1b.png[/img]下面哪个选项在调用函数时会报错( ) A: test ([2,4,5]) B: test (3.4) C: test ((12,4,5)) D: test ('abcesf')
- 4
建立模块a.py,模块内容如下。def B(): print('BBB')def A(): print('AAA')为了调用模块中的A()函数,应先使用语句______ 。